Reports
Reports are predefined and data driven. To utilize reports, simply select the report type you are interested in within the Explorer Bar.
The available report types are as follows:
- Backflow Device Reports
- Backflow Device Testers
- Cross-Connection Specialists
- Non-Potable Sites
- Cross-Connection Tests
- Inspections
- Site List
- Summary
- Water Service Inspections
Selecting any one of these reports in the explorer bar will generate the report. The report can then be save to file, emailed, or printed by using the corresponding tool on the toolbar located above the report.
Backflow Device Annual Summary Report
The Backflow Device Annual Summary Report lists the statistics for each backflow device type. This report includes a Report Year tool located in the toolbar above the report.
The Report Year tool list the last ten years to choose from. Changing the report year will regenerate the report based on the year selected.
Backflow Device Outstanding Tests Report
The Backflow Device Outstanding Tests Report lists all of the tests that are currently pending. These backflow device tests are either past due or the customer has recently been sent a notice to test.
Listed are the account numbers, notice types, device types, serial numbers, last test dates, and due dates for each outstanding backflow device test.
Stolen Backflow Device List
The Stolen Backflow Device List lists all backflow devices that have been marked as stolen. Listed are the device types, serial numbers, manufacturers, models, sizes, and the dates removed (stolen) from the water service.
Public Backflow Device Testers List
The Public Backflow Device Testers List is a list of certified backflow device testers that gets enclosed with the notice to test notices that are sent to water service customers as part of the annual backflow device testing.
This list is based on a template that is user defined. Backflow device testers that have expired certification that fall outside of the user definable grace period, have had their certification suspended, or are not marked as "Include In Public Testers List" in the Backflow Device Testers database do not get included in the Public Backflow Device Testers List.
Internal Backflow Device Testers List
The Internal Backflow Device Testers List is a complete list of all certified backflow device testers within the Backflow Device Testers database. It is intended for internal use only, not to be included with the annual notice to test notices that are sent to the water service customers.
Backflow Device Testers Request for Information
The Backflow Device Testers Request for Information Letter is a user definable template based letter that can be sent to all certified backflow device testers for updating the backflow device testers database.
This letter can include a request for information on current certification number, expiration date, gauge number, etc.
Selecting Backflow Device Testers Request for Information will generate a letter for every certified backflow device tester in the database. They can then be printed or saved to file by using the appropriate tool within the toolbar located above the letter(s) generated.

Cross-Connection Tests Completed
The Cross-Connection Tests Completed Report lists all of the cross-connection tests that have been completed during the selected date range. The default date range begins with the first day in January for the current year and ends with the current date.
You can select any date range you wish, as long as the From Date value is before the To Date value. Once the date range has been changed, the Recalculate tool in the toolbar above the report is activated. Clicking on the Recalculate tool generates the report for the selected date range.
Listed in the report are the test dates, site numbers, site names, site locations, and site cities for each completed cross-connection test within the selected date range.
Cross-Connection Tests Outstanding
The Cross-Connection Tests Outstanding Report lists all of the cross-connection tests that are currently pending. These cross-connection tests are either past due or the customer is in the process of correcting violations.
Listed are the test dates, site numbers, site names, site locations, and site cities for each outstanding cross-connection test.
Cross-Connection Tests Upcoming
The Cross-Connection Tests Upcoming Report lists all of the cross-connection tests that have yet to be performed within the current year.
Listed are the test months, site numbers, site names, site locations, and site cities for each upcoming cross-connection test.
